PPE for the frontline
As lockdown took us by surprise, PPE was in very short supply. When we were instructed to work from home, we rounded up all of our FFP2 masks, goggles and safety glasses and dropped them off to the nursing staff at Arrowe Park Hospital.
Designated the UK’s first quarantine site during the pandemic, this flagship hospital on the Wirral has been at the forefront of the fight against the virus since the very start.
“It’s so nice to know that people care and want to help, a big thank you from the team for the PPE, we appreciate it.” - Arrowe Park Hospital
£15,000 covid care package giveaway
The coronavirus proved difficult for all of us, but especially so for many charitable organisations struggling with financial difficulties. With this in mind, we launched an initiative to give something back to our local community and help charities and good causes to continue the fight against the pandemic.
We put together 10 care packages made up from our Covid-combatting products, including gloves, masks, aprons, hand sanitiser and wipes, each worth over £1,000. Via social media we invited people to nominate organisations they thought would benefit and were blown away by the response.
It was too difficult to choose just 10 from all the brilliant causes put forward, so we added another 10 smaller care packages worth £500 each to be able to help as many charities as we could. In these uncertain times, small acts of kindness make a huge difference and we were delighted our deliveries helped raise a smile and support our local community.
Johnny Vegas delivers care package
We donated a care package to the team at Willowbrook Hospice kindly delivered by none other than Merseyside comedy star Johnny Vegas, a keen supporter of the hospice which cared for his dad.
Willowbrook Hospice is an independent charity established in 1993 by local people to raise funds to build and run a specialist palliative care unit in St Helens.
We’re pleased the team will benefit from the hand sanitiser, PPE and drinking water as they continue their incredible work.
“Thank you Heatons for your kind donation, everyone here is extremely grateful and very happy to see it safely delivered.” - Willowbrook Hospice
